🍺 What Exactly Is an Industrial Lager?

First things first: what makes a beer "industrial"? 🤔 Think of it this way – industrial lagers are typically mass-produced with efficiency in mind. They prioritize consistency over complexity, often using adjuncts like corn or rice instead of pure barley malt. These beers aim for affordability rather than flavor innovation. Brands like Budweiser or Miller fit snugly into this category. But does Carlsberg fall under the same umbrella? Let’s dive deeper! 💡


🌍 Carlsberg’s Brewing Philosophy Across Borders

Carlsberg originated in Denmark back in 1847, where its founder J.C. Jacobsen aimed to revolutionize beer quality by introducing science into brewing 🧪🍻. Over time, Carlsberg expanded globally, adapting recipes to suit local tastes while maintaining core principles. In some regions, their production might lean more toward industrial standards due to market demands. However, many craft versions still honor the original recipe featuring noble hops and bottom-fermenting yeast strains. So, is your pint truly industrial… or just misunderstood? 🤷‍♂️
